Selecting Your Perfect Water Softener Size

Figuring out the best water conditioning size can feel overwhelming, but it doesn't have to be! This resource will walk you through the process of calculating a unit effectively for your household. We’ll evaluate several key elements, starting with your water hardness – typically measured in parts per million. A higher hardness level will demand a larger capacity conditioner. You also need to take into consideration your water consumption, usually based on the number of individuals in your home. Generally, you can figure around 80 gallons of water consumption per person, per week. In addition, consider the regeneration frequency – more frequent regeneration lowers the overall system's size requirements. Choosing your Right Water Softener Capacity: Hardness vs. Gallons

Understanding ion softener size is essential for optimal operation and guaranteeing soft liquid throughout your residence. Most people become confused when analyzing hardness and gallon ratings. Generally, a grain measurement indicates the amount of hardness minerals, typically calcium and magnesium, that a system can process per regeneration. Conversely, volume points to the total fluid quantity the softener can treat before undergoing a regeneration. Therefore, use a capacity chart based on your household's average liquid usage in capacity and convert that to a hardness need to find the correct unit.
